Compilerfehler C3457
Aktualisiert: November 2007
Fehlermeldung
'Attribut': Attribut lässt keine unbenannten Argumente zu
'attribute': attribute does not support unnamed arguments
Quellcodeanmerkungen unterstützen im Gegensatz zu benutzerdefinierten CLR-Attributen oder Compilerattributen ausschließlich benannte Argumente.
Beispiel
Im folgenden Beispiel wird C3457 generiert.
#include "SourceAnnotations.h"
[vc_attributes::Post( 1 )] int f(); // C3457
[vc_attributes::Post( Valid=vc_attributes::Yes )] int f2(); // OK